10 tips to save on your car rental in and around Cooperstown

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by selecting vehicle type and features. Whether you require an SUV for added space, a convertible for sunny days, or an economy car for budget-friendly travel, utilise the filters on Expedia to discover the ideal match for your journey.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ental prices can vary based on demand, so it's advisable to secure your car well ahead of your trip. By booking in advance, you are more likely to obtain lower rates and enjoy greater availability, particularly during peak se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Smaller cars are typically more affordable to rent and easier to park in crowded areas. Mid-size rentals offer a good compromise between cost,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under the age of 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ily surcharges, and certain types of vehicles—such as SUVs or premium models—might not be available. This could also apply to renters over the age of 70. Always verify the age requirements before making a booking.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rentals operate under a full-to-full fuel policy, meaning you must return the car with a full tank to avoid additional charges. This is generally the most advantageous option. Others might offer full-to-empty or prepaid fuel options, which can also be acceptable. Just ensure that you return the car empty in this case.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: There is often a surcharge for collecting your rental car at airports, but the added convenience may make it worthwhile.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ies exclusively accept credit cards as a payment method.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unnecessary expenses and provide peace of mind if the unexpected occurs during your trip. Adding car rental insurance is straightforward when booking with Expedia.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you plan on taking long road trips, search for rentals that offer unlimited mileage to prevent incurring extra costs.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is essential for renting a car.

How old do you have to be to rent a car in Cooperstown?
Cooperstown requires drivers to be 21 and above to be able to rent a vehicle. However, young drivers can expect an extra charge and stricter rental conditions. Most suppliers impose a daily young renter fee in addition to the usual rental rate. This helps cover the extra risk of accident or damage. While many car classes (like economy and compact) are available to young drivers, restrictions generally apply to specialty and luxury vehicles.
What do you need to rent a car in Cooperstown?
Be prepared to present your driver's licence and a credit card in your name at the rental counter. Prior to pickup, check with your selected company whether anything else is needed. For example, you may also need to provide proof of insurance.

Can I drive in Cooperstown with my current driver's license?
If you don't have a license from the U.S, you may be required to apply for an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your country of residence before starting the home process. If you find that an IDP is required for you to drive in the U.S., be aware that you'll also have to show your current driver's license and your passport or other form of ID. Lastly, the credit card you used to rent the vehicle needs to match the name on your license and passport in order to confirm your home. Other things you should know about rental cars in the U.S. Are:
  • Age restrictions: You need to be 25 or older in most states to be able to rent a car, although in some places, the minimum age is 21 years. We recommend checking local rules and regulations, as well as the car rental website before you book to understand additional terms and conditions.
  • Driving limitations: Read the fine print before you get behind the wheel so you can avoid unnecessary fees. When renting a car in the United States, you typically can't cross country borders into Mexico or Canada, drive on ferries or traverse certain types of rugged terrain with a rental car.
